    Default The Mike Richards for Simmonds/Schenn/2nd Round Pick - Still Do It?

    Especially knowing everything that we know now about what Simmonds is capable of, do we still do this trade?

    I've still got my massive man-crush on Simmonds, and looking at what he's been able to do with Philly makes me regret losing him, especially in light of a "quiet" Mike Richards regular season (I think that's fair to say).

    Simmonds was yet another victim in the amazing TM offensive system (along with Moulson and Purcell), and combined with the stalled development of Kyle Clifford (who many here thought made Simmonds disposable), I wonder if this is a trade that becomes pretty lopsided, sooner rather than later. I think that everybody felt it was a now vs. the future type of trade, but Simmonds has already started big dividends, and Schenn's not far at all.

    Schenn was a legitimate blue-chip prospect, and I think his development/progression is right on track. He's a known quantity. And that second-rounder is what it is.

    But Simmonds almost felt like an ancillary/auxiliary piece of this trade, and with what he turned out to be, along with what Schenn's going to be... man!

    The trade wasn't so much about numbers as it was character.

    In the end, the Kings got a hard-nosed former captain who could score and would seemingly be willing to chew through a brick wall in order to win his shift.

    What they let go was a young centerman who was essentially replaced by the guy they were picking up, who was a much more known quantity.

    As for Simmonds, he was a nice player with upside, but scuttlebutt and hearsay say that we moved a potential locker room... well, not "problem" or "distraction" as much as a... well, let's call it "influence." And that netted us what could be a more focused young blueliner in the process.
